The S8 is now back home with me - a total of 8 working days turnaround from cats coming off to car being completed. They were shipped on a Monday, arrived Weds in Germany and as far I can tell were probably return shipped on Thursday, given that they turned up on the Monday morning in the UK!

As I mentioned before the cost of re-coring both cats, including return delivery was just under £720, plus £30 to get them to Germany, so call it £750 all in for the cats.

Removal and fitting, the cost of which you'd have whether fitting new or refurbished, came in at £270. Lambda probe was the only unexpected element at £110.

So all in I've spent £1,130 to have it back how it should be....

Sounds a lot, but if I'd gone the OEM route I would've spent £950 for one cat, plus probably £180 for fitting, just for the offside one so exactly the same spend!

I haven't driven it far yet, but the exhaust now sounds a lot sweeter - I suspect the failing cat was upsetting the exhaust balance. Not having a distinct rattle coming from under the car is also reminding me how smooth it used to sound!

It will be interesting to see if I can detect any difference in performance once I've had an opportunity to warm it through properly and exercise the engine a bit more
